Which of these tables represents a linear function?
wlad13 [49]

Answer:

Table 1

Step-by-step explanation:

For a function to be linear, equal changes in x must correspond to equal changes in y.

In all tables, the x values increase by 1, so all changes in x in all 4 tables are 1.

If a function is linear, then all changes in y must be equal.

Table 1:

5 - 6 = -1

4 - 5 = -1

3 - 4 = -1

All changes in y are equal, so the first table is linear.

Table 2:

4 - 3 = 1

6 - 4 = 2

Two differences in y are different, so table 2 is not linear.

Table 3:

6 - 7 = -1

5 - 6 = -1

3 - 5 = -2

Not all differences in y are equal, so table 3 is not linear.

Table 4:

4 - 2 = 2

5 - 4 = 1

Not all differences in y are equal, so table 3 is not linear.

The only table that has equal differences in y corresponding to equal differences in x is Table 1, so only Table 1 shows a linear function.
